centos

centos sftp配置中常见错误

小樊
54
2025-04-12 17:32:04
栏目: 智能运维

在CentOS上配置SFTP服务时,可能会遇到一些常见错误。以下是一些典型的错误及其解决方法:

  1. 权限问题

    • 错误描述:用户根目录权限设置不当。
    • 解决方法:确保用户主目录的权限设置正确。例如,使用以下命令:
      chown root:sftp /www/
      chmod 755 /www/
      
  2. 配置文件错误

    • 错误描述sshd_config文件中的配置错误。
    • 解决方法:确保sshd_config文件中的配置正确,例如:
      Subsystem sftp internal-sftp
      Match Group sftp
        ChrootDirectory /www/
        ForceCommand internal-sftp
      
  3. 目录设置问题

    • 错误描述:SFTP主目录设置错误。
    • 解决方法:确保SFTP主目录存在并且权限设置正确。例如:
      mkdir /www/
      chown root:sftp /www/
      chmod 755 /www/
      
  4. 连接错误

    • 错误描述:连接时出现“Broken pipe”或“Connection reset by peer”错误。
    • 解决方法:检查用户根目录权限和SELinux设置。确保目录权限为755,并且SELinux设置为disabled:
      getenforce
      setenforce 0
      

这些常见错误通常是由于配置错误和权限问题引起的,通过检查和修正这些配置可以解决大部分问题。

0
看了该问题的人还看了